The foundation of the Navy diving program consists of the Navy Diver (ND) rating for enlisted personnel who perform diving as their occupational specialty in the Navy. Some of the mission areas of the Navy diver include: marine salvage, harbor clearance, underwater ship husbandry and repair, submarine rescue, saturation diving, experimental diving, underwater construction and welding, as well as serving as technical experts to the Navy SEALs, Marine Corps, and Navy EOD diving commands. Battle Damage and Ship repair operations require the use of state of the art diving equipment, underwater cutting and welding, Non-Destructive testing, digital video equipment, complex rigging operations, hydraulic tool systems and precision demolition materials. The Navys Underwater Demolition Teams (UDT) were created when bomb disposal experts and Seabees (combat engineers) teamed together in 1943 to devise methods for removing obstacles the Germans were placing off the beaches of France. The navy diver rating was announced in Naval Administration Message 003/06 and consists of sailors with the following NECs: The effective date of the ND rating was June 1, 2006 for E6-E9 (senior non-commissioned officers), and October 1, 2006, for E1-E5 junior enlisted. Additionally, there is a scuba diver qualification primarily for those stationed on submarines to serve as sub divers in a limited capacity.
